Cardinals: Ex-Eagles CB Could Fill Need

The Arizona Cardinals are facing a crucial offseason, with a glaring need at cornerback being a top priority. The team struggled mightily in the secondary last season, ranking 30th in passing yards allowed. With the departure of veteran Byron Murphy Jr., the Cardinals are looking for a reliable player to solidify the position. One name that could be a solid option is former Philadelphia Eagles cornerback, Darius Slay.

Slay's Experience and Talent

Slay is a proven veteran with a wealth of experience in the NFL. He's a two-time Pro Bowler and a one-time All-Pro, boasting a reputation for being a shutdown corner. His physicality and aggressive play style make him a formidable presence on the field.

Slay's strengths:

  • Strong tackling ability: Slay is not afraid to come up and make tackles, making him a valuable asset against the run.
  • Excellent coverage skills: He possesses the speed and agility to stay with even the fastest receivers, consistently disrupting passing plays.
  • Leadership and experience: Slay is a vocal leader and a veteran presence in the locker room, qualities that would be valuable for a Cardinals team looking to turn things around.

Why Slay Could Be a Good Fit

The Cardinals could benefit significantly from Slay's experience and talent. He would immediately upgrade the cornerback position and provide a much-needed boost to the secondary.

Key factors:

  • Fits the scheme: Arizona's defensive scheme is designed to pressure the quarterback, and Slay's ability to disrupt receivers would fit perfectly.
  • Veteran leadership: With a young and rebuilding roster, Slay's leadership and guidance could be invaluable for developing younger players.
  • Playoff experience: Slay has played in the playoffs and understands what it takes to compete at a high level, a valuable asset for a Cardinals team with aspirations to return to the postseason.

The Potential Challenges

While Slay's arrival would undoubtedly improve the Cardinals' defense, there are a few potential challenges to consider:

  • Age: At 32, Slay is on the older side for a cornerback, and his production might decline in the coming years.
  • Contract: His contract status and potential cost could be a factor for the Cardinals, especially with a limited amount of cap space.

Conclusion

Darius Slay is a talented cornerback with a proven track record of success. He could be a valuable asset to the Cardinals, providing much-needed experience, leadership, and a shutdown presence in the secondary. While there are potential challenges, the benefits of acquiring Slay outweigh the risks. If the Cardinals are serious about improving their defense, they should strongly consider making a move for the former Eagles standout.
